The new derivation presented for an algorithm that fuses two Kalman filter outputs clearly demonstrates the combination of estimates to be capable of 'optimally' minimizing the trace of the fused covariance matrix. The method also furnishes an estimate whose error ellipses are contained within the intersection of the error ellipses from each filter. The 'reinitialized Kalman filter' obtained by these means is applied to the problem of lunar rendezvous.
